Rowley Massachusetts Revolutionary War Memorial
Inscription.
To the memory of those
brave Rowley colonists whose sacrifice during
the Revolutionary War
for
American Independence
gave us a free nation
May such patriotism
ever be with us.
Dedicated July 4, 2009.
Erected 2009.

Location. 42° 42.857′ N, 70° 52.861′ W. Marker is in Rowley, Massachusetts, in Essex County. Memorial is on Main Street (Massachusetts Route 1A), on the left when traveling south. Marker is one of two war memorials in a grassy median. Touch for map. Marker is at or near this postal address: 113 Main Street, Rowley MA 01969, United States of America. Touch for directions.
